Key Features of Escalators and Sidewalks

  1. Space Optimization: Modern escalators and moving sidewalks are designed to fit seamlessly into any building layout, maximizing the available space while providing essential transportation solutions. Their compact designs allow for installation in narrow hallways and crowded areas.

  2. Advanced Safety Mechanisms: Today’s escalators and moving sidewalks come equipped with features such as emergency stop buttons, handrail speed synchronization, and auto-braking systems. These innovations prioritize user safety, reducing the risk of accidents.

  3. Energy Efficiency: Many contemporary installations utilize energy-efficient motors and systems that consume less power, thus lowering operating costs and minimizing environmental impact. Eco-friendly options are increasingly becoming the norm among leading escalators and sidewalks suppliers.

  4. User-Friendly Controls: Intuitive control panels, often with digital displays, make navigating escalators and sidewalks straightforward. These user-friendly interfaces empower individuals to make informed choices about their mobility.

  5. Customization Options: Many suppliers offer customizable designs to match specific architectural aesthetics. Options often include varying colors, materials, and finishes to blend seamlessly with the building's overall design.

Pricing and Cost-Effectiveness

Acquiring escalators and sidewalks comes with various pricing tiers, largely influenced by factors such as size, customization, and technological features. Basic models might start around $20,000, while more advanced systems can reach beyond $100,000. It's essential to consider the long-term investment aspect—while the initial costs may seem high, the return on investment can be substantial through enhanced user flow and property value.
